Novak Djokovic improved to 19-0 in the first round of the U.S. Open, battling through some leg troubles to beat Learner Tien 6-1, 7-6 (3), 6-2 on Sunday night.
He's the first man ever to win 80 matches in the largest tennis stadium in the world, since it made its debut in 1997.
